Ingo Laufs is a Lecturer at Kalaidos University of Applied Sciences and Hanover University of Music, Theater and Media, specializing in Music Theory, Arrangement, and Composition for Jazz/Pop and Classical contexts. He teaches Tonsatz, Formenlehre, Musikgeschichte, and Gehörbildung, while creating professional orchestral arrangements of pop/rock hits. His work focuses on symphonic integration of genres, as seen in collaborations with the Volkswagen Philharmonic Orchestra and Moscow Philharmonic Orchestra.
